We present an appearance-based user interface for artists to efficiently design customized image-based lighting environments. 1 Our approach avoids typical iterations of parameter editing, rendering, and confirmation by providing a set of intuitive user interfaces for directly specifying the desired appearance of the model in the scene. Then the system automatically creates the lighting environment by solving the inverse shading problem. To obtain a realistic image, all-frequency lighting is used with a spherical radial basis function (SRBF) representation. Rendering is performed using precomputed radiance transfer (PRT) to achieve a responsive speed. User experiments demonstrated the effectiveness of the proposed system compared to a previous approach.
